Founded in 1894, City, University of London is a global university committed to academic excellence with a focus on business and the professions and an enviable central London location.
City attracts around 20,000 students (over 40% postgraduate level) from more than 150 countries and staff from over 75 countries.
In the last decade, City has almost tripled the proportion of its total academic staff producing world-leading or internationally excellent research. During this period, City has made significant investments in its academic staff, its estate and its infrastructure and continues to work towards realizing its vision of being a leading global university.

Background
City’s Information Assurance Team is seeking a passionate and enthusiastic Information Assurance Specialist. If you know that the answer to every data protection question is “it depends” and why, we would like to hear from you. The small but influential team, reporting to the Chief Operating Officer, is responsible for all aspects of City’s compliance with the Data Protection Legislation, as well as compliance with the Freedom of Information Act, 2000. Data protection is a critical pillar of City’s governance structure.
Responsibilities
The role holder will be a Project specialist; advising on key projects and workstreams involving complex data protection matters, to include review of DPIAs and contracts, and international data transfers. You will also work on complex Case Management, internal reviews and complaints investigation and annual NHS DSPT Submission.
